WebThe relation of incompatibility is the most general type of semantic relation among lexical items, the meaning of which entails exclusion (e.g. Lyons 1977, Cruse 1986). According to the theoretical approach, lexical units exhibiting a specific sense hold a relation of incompatibility if they fall under a common single superordinate. WebA declaration of incompatibility in UK constitutional law is a declaration issued by a United Kingdom judge that a statute is incompatible with the European Convention of Human Rights under the Human Rights Act 1998 section 4. This is a central part of UK constitutional law.Very few declarations of incompatibility have been issued, in comparison to the … WebWhen a new declaration of incompatibility is made in the domestic courts , the lead department is expected to bring it to the Joint Committee’s attention. The Ministry of Justice encourages departments to update the Joint Committee regularly on their plans for responding to declarations of incompatibility. greek food in indianapolis

It is also called ABO blood type … WebMar 4, 2015 · Since the Human Rights Act came into force on 2 October 2000, UK courts have made 29 declarations of incompatibility, of which 20 have become final. During the 2010-2015 Parliament, however, only three declarations of incompatibility have been made, and one of those is still subject to appeal.

WebBackground: There is increasing evidence of good short-term and medium-term outcomes of ABO incompatible (ABOi) and HLA incompatible (HLAi) kidney transplantation with pre-transplant positive crossmatches in paediatric practice. However, there remain concerns regarding the higher risks of infective complications and antibody-mediated rejections.
